Output c5aa670d4d086bbea138293d2bfd84519080abd1753035adc11d7e10e241f71e:2

value
187420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d954189799d3a3fc0a86a84194c54bc68a780e2 OP_EQUAL
address
3D93C1czvA7MoT13QwMPXfnnyoeuRgQdEP
transaction
c5aa670d4d086bbea138293d2bfd84519080abd1753035adc11d7e10e241f71e
spent
true